Madame Isabelle'S House Hostel - New Orleans
29.96647, -90.06237The 3-star Madame Isabelle'S House is located merely 0.6 miles from Cafe du Monde beignets and a mere 0.7 miles from French Quarter. Offering a summer terrace and a picnic area, the New Orleans hostel is set in Faubourg Marigny district.
Location
While staying at this hostel, guests have access to Washington Square Park. Serving different delicacies, Gene's Po-Boys is situated within convenient reach of the accommodation.
New Orleans Lakefront airport is around 15 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Madame Isabelle'S House features 7 rooms. A separate toilet and showers are provided in the bathroom with a separate toilet and showers. Some rooms come with a bathroom with a walk-in shower.
Eat & Drink
At the hotel Madame Isabelle'S House guests are invited to a full breakfast served for free.
